Customer Logistics Analyst- Walmart & Sam's

Remote, USA Full-time
About the position Utz Quality Foods is seeking a Customer Logistics Analyst to join our team working on Walmart and Sam's. Reporting to the Head of Customer Logistics-Walmart and Sam's, this role is responsible for supporting the customer logistics strategy and execution plan to deliver target customer service levels, cost improvement, inventory, and cash collection targets. The position is responsible for identifying opportunities for continued efficiency improvements and developing reporting, root cause analysis, and action plans throughout the Walmart and Sam's distribution networks. The analyst will be responsible for defining supply chain policies, KPIs, and other targets and collaborating across sales, supply chain, and the customer to improve all metrics inclusive of service, cost-to-serve, and fine reduction. This is a remote position with travel as needed. This role can be based in Bentonville, AR, Hanover, PA; Dallas, TX; State College, PA; and Chicago, IL. Responsibilities • Perform analysis within the Utz route to market system to ensure optimal cost and service targets. • Conduct transactional level analysis to create actionable insights for order trends and improvements. • Perform analysis across order to cash value chain to determine impacts to cost, service, and waste. • Manage GRS settings with co-managed approach with customer to ensure optimal orders to drive logistics efficiencies. • Work collaboratively with Walmart and Sam's to successfully implement supply chain policies and initiatives, improve customer KPIs, and identify mutually beneficial wins. • Create and present relative period KPI metrics to senior management and sales to ensure organizational alignment. • Analyze, validate, manipulate, and interpret complex data from cross functional partners to develop solutions and optimization opportunities. • Lead cross-functional teams to improve OTIF and SQEP targets and reduce fines. • Collaborate with customer and MDM team to drive robust customer and product data governance and ensure data synchronization with customer using our industry standards. • Analyze internal and external data sets to understand customer demand cycles, order patterns, and other trends to improve service and cost to serve. • Address all ad hoc customer related issues and analysis requests as they arise. • Develop strong relationship with sales to ensure all needs are met. • Develop appropriate and clear metrics across all key performance indicators (KPIs) for channel to ensure strong performance management. • Become Retail Link SME for organization. Requirements • Degree in business, supply chain, engineering, or equivalent combination of education and experience. • 2-5 years work experience, strong business and broad supply chain acumen to include the end-to-end order management process. • Experience managing and connecting large, complex data sets. • Experience creating visual analytics particularly with Microsoft Power BI. • Advanced experience in Excel (VLOOKUP, Pivot Tables, Charts, Graphs minimum required). • Experience with ERP and TMS (Microsoft Dynamics 365 and e2open BluJay a plus). • Order management, customer service, and/or customer fulfillment. • Collaborative planning, forecasting, and replenishment a plus. • Advanced knowledge and skill with Microsoft Office Suite. • Ability to lead and manage multiple projects simultaneously and operate cross-functionally. • Ability to work and thrive in a fast-paced environment. • Skilled in analytical thinking and data-based decision-making. • Outcome focused and a strong commitment to continuous improvement.
